Output c15f8cfc25aed8ebd6e3f70092b71e155185754e53a0ce58b51a8af6b0dd6c15:10

value
1375612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dbb6641fd2da8b213599bbe42ca8caecb036bec OP_EQUAL
address
3JzE8YMRQCmDkfLAoNKzxyj43FfBSz8dv5
transaction
c15f8cfc25aed8ebd6e3f70092b71e155185754e53a0ce58b51a8af6b0dd6c15
confirmations
267243
spent
true